Because … WebMar 11, 2024 · When a male lion breeds with a female tiger, we call the offspring a liger. A tigon is, well, you guessed it: the offspring of a male tiger and a female lion. Interestingly, a liger typically grows larger than either of its parents, probably because it lacks certain growth-limiting genes. Females advertise their readiness to mate. A few days before she enters estrus, the female will scent-mark her range more frequently with a distinctive smelling urine.
